Bee Varroa Scanner (BeeVS)
AI-based scanner for counting Varroa destructors
DescriptionOverview of the initiative and its approach.
BeeVS is an electronic scanner that is able to photograph beehive trays and count the number of varroa mites using a trained artificial intelligence (AI) algorithm. The scanner collects standard statistical data on the spread of varroa across the entire apiary, contributing to a reduction in the number of varroa treatments by limiting applications to families that show a critical infestation threshold; reducing the time needed to carry out checks; documenting the spread of varroa at an apiary level; and identifying varroa outbreaks at the beginning of the beekeeping season, thus avoiding the infestation of all colonies in the apiary.
TechnologyTechnology used by the initiative.
BeeVS technology uses a scanner and AI algorithm to count and monitor over time the number of parasites in each beehive.

Business modelHow the initiative delivers and sustains its value.
AI-powered Bee Varroa Scanner can be purchased or provided as service to beekeepers, farm advisors, research centres or private companies. The scanner is made available by beekeepers adopting beehives via the “Sustain hive adoption” project promoted by the partner “17tons”. When provided as a service, the cost for each sheet scansion varies from country to country.
ImpactThe observed or intended effects of the initiative.
The website reports that as of September 2024, Bee Varroa Scanners had counted over 6 million varroa mites since their first adoption, scanned over 50 000 beehives and saved around 700 hours of manual work.
